Vex Posted January 2, 2011 Share Posted January 2, 2011 You want high LP, low defence. I'd recommend Living Rock Creatures in Void. Living rock creatures give 4.5/4.6 xp per 10lp of damage dealt. Which is a 10-12% increase in xp over most other creatures (bar bosses and dragons). Their drops aren't amazing but you won't lose any money, and you will get a few charms. Don't mine their corpses as it's far too slow - and defeats the purpose of power training. Sinkhan Posted January 2, 2011 Share Posted January 2, 2011 Why have you knocked off slayer? FSH + fero is a pretty good combo and there are a good number of creatures that are rangeable. Karil's xbow would probably be your best bet as it combines a great combination of strength, speed (which greatly augments the fero), and accuracy. If not that, I suggest addy darts as they're relatively cheap and tick faster.
